Transaction 78a80ca6371cdb75328e802449ffb95545bde553329312baafd0250810cb465e

1 Input
1 Outputs
  • 78a80ca6371cdb75328e802449ffb95545bde553329312baafd0250810cb465e:0
  • value  13840
    address  1AFfHZtUSMXCiowhCvc24ZQ5qZDfFQKMHN